Based on the HOA president quote, this prez sets a BAD example for other HOA's.

Soldier's landscaper skips town right before he is called up for active duty and the Developer/HOA presidents tells the media he will sue the soldier. HOA prez is quoted as saying "I really don't give an [expletive] where he is or what his problem is".

When the HOA prez is told you can't sue an active military member his response it "This clown gets to do what he wants and I'm mad as hell."

Result, the community got together and did all the work. The soldier won't see it for a year and the loudmouth developer (imo) was a no show and wouldn't respond to media questions. Guess he realized just what a idiot he was with his previous responses.
